Apps to know about
Marathon runners and sidewalk sprinters find plenty to love about free Android apps like
iSmoothRun, Map My Run and Runkeeper. With its built-in pedometer and GPS capability,
iSmoothRun helps active moms set fitness goals and track their progress as they achieve them. This
amazing app also comes with a metronome that propels joggers along at a determined pace, says
Healthline magazine.
Map My Run helps joggers find recommended routes and provides elevation and running speed, too.
Moms who enjoy a certain jogging route can provide reviews to other local runners with this
portable smartphone app. When visiting a new city, jogging mommies can learn about great jogging
paths and routes with Map My Run. Runkeeper offers a range of running information, including
distance traveled, steps taken, and calories burned. Runkeeper comes with preset training programs
that can help new moms get fit and stay that way. Enable the audio feedback setting to get periodic
progress reports without taking your phone out of your pocket.
Thermal jogging suit or shorts?
Moms who jog are sure to appreciate a weather app for Android phones. With a handy smartphone
app such as the Weather Live Free app from Apalon, busy mommies can take a quick peek at the
weather before jumping into appropriate running garb and hitting the sidewalk for some healthy
exercise. This cool little app can help moms plan ahead for a timely jog as well as provide local
temperature for a right-now run. Weather maps and radar rain info make this handy app just right
for jogging moms who run with smartphones or don Android Wear when they head out to door for
their daily exercise.
Healthy mom, healthy heart
If you’re a mom, you probably spend a good deal of your day chasing kids around the house.
Remember the importance of having some good outdoor fun, as well. The clean, user-friendly
interface of Cardio Trainer offers jogging moms a super simple way to map outdoor routes and stay
motivated. Available at Google Play, this fitness technology app offers a robust music feature, says
Lifewire magazine. Another free Android app they recommend is Runtastic. Although is has no music
player, and it doesn’t show your route until you’re done with your run, Runtastic is a favorite free
tool for all sorts of heart-healthy activities.
